America Responds to Trump’s Speech: ‘That Was Me Up There Speaking’
Breitbart ^ | 7/22/2016 | Rebecca Mansour

Posted on 07/23/2016 7:29:06 AM PDT by orchestra

Callers to Friday’s episode of Breitbart News Daily on SiriusXM expressed their appreciation for the candor of Donald Trump’s acceptance speech at the Republican National Convention in Cleveland Thursday night.

Eddie in Florida, a Latino branch manager for an industrial homes company, said that Trump “talked to me like a human being as though I was sitting across a table from him.”

He added that he talks to his blue-collar co-workers the same way that Trump spoke to the nation.
